The TC74HC4051AF(EL,F) is a high-speed CMOS analog multiplexer/demultiplexer fabricated by Toshiba Semiconductor and Storage, utilizing silicon gate CMOS technology. This device features low on-resistance and high off-resistance, making it suitable for various analog and digital signal switching applications.
Applications
- Analog signal selection
- Data acquisition systems
- Audio and video signal routing
- Communication systems
- Test and measurement equipment
Features
- Low on-resistance: RON = 70 Ω (typ.) at VCC = 5 V
- High off-resistance: ROFF = 100 MΩ (min.)
- Wide operating voltage range: VCC = 2 V to 6 V
- Low power dissipation: ICC = 4 μA (max.) at Ta = 25°C
- High noise immunity: VNIH = VNIL = 28 % VCC (min.)
- Control input levels: VIL = 0.8 V (max.), VIH = 2.0 V (min.)

Additional Details
The TC74HC4051AF(EL,F) is an 8-channel multiplexer/demultiplexer. It comes in a SOP package. The device is designed to operate over a wide temperature range and is RoHS compliant. The EL and F suffixes indicate specific packaging and taping options.
